Beyond the translation

Song interpretation

The song 'Ragasiyamaanadhu Kaadhal' explores the enigmatic, divine, and unexpressed nature of true love. It details how love operates in secrecy and silence, finding contentment even in unrequited longing or unsaid emotions. Love cannot be forced, traded, or easily defined through physical touch. Drawing parallels to natural elements like fragrance, light, water, and fire, the lyrics convey that love transcends simple sensory perception. Ultimately, the song compares love to the divine, emphasizing that it is an innate, spiritual experience that must be felt deep within one's soul.

Writing craft

Poetic devices

Simile (Uwamai)

Kaadhalum kadavulai polae

Compares love directly to God using the comparative word 'polae'.

Paradox / Oxymoron

Indha sogam thaanae kaadhalilae sugamaanadhu

Juxtaposes 'sogam' (sorrow) and 'sugam' (pleasure/joy) to show how heartbreak or silent yearning in love creates a unique, sweet pain.

Repetition (Adukku Thodar)

Miga miga ragasiyamaanadhu kaadhal

Repeats 'miga miga' (very very) and 'thedi thedi' (searching searching) for emotional emphasis and musical rhythm.

Simile (Uwamai)

Vaasanai velichathai polae

Compares love to elements like light, fragrance, water, and fire to highlight its intangible yet powerful essence.

Did you know?

Trivia

The song 'Ragasiyamaanadhu Kaadhal' features in the 2006 Tamil romantic drama film 'Kodambakkam', directed by D. Suresh and starring Navdeep and Diya. The soundtrack was composed by Sirpy, with lyrics penned by Yugabharathi and sung soulfully by Harish Raghavendra.
